如何优化阿里云主机数据库的性能以提升查询速度?

在当今数字化时代,随着企业业务的不断扩展,数据量呈指数级增长。这使得对数据库的高效管理和优化变得至关重要。本文将探讨如何通过优化阿里云主机上的数据库性能来提高查询速度。

如何优化阿里云主机数据库的性能以提升查询速度?

选择合适的数据库引擎

对于不同的应用场景,选择适合的数据库引擎是至关重要的。阿里云提供了多种类型的数据库服务,包括关系型数据库(如MySQL、PostgreSQL)和NoSQL数据库(如Redis、MongoDB)。根据实际需求选择合适的数据库类型,并确保其版本是最新的稳定版,可以为后续的性能优化奠定良好基础。

合理配置硬件资源

为了保证数据库的最佳性能表现,必须为其分配足够的计算能力、内存以及存储空间等硬件资源。可以通过调整ECS实例规格或增加SSD云盘容量等方式实现这一目标。在多台服务器之间建立集群架构也有助于分散负载压力并增强系统的容错性。

优化SQL语句结构

编写高效的SQL查询语句能够显著改善数据库读取效率。尽量避免使用SELECT FROM table_name 这样的全表扫描操作;尽可能利用索引来加速特定字段的查找过程;减少不必要的JOIN连接次数;适当运用LIMIT限制返回结果的数量。同时注意定期清理过期无用的数据记录,保持表格结构精简。

创建与维护索引

索引就像一本书籍后面的目录一样重要,它可以帮助快速定位所需信息。在关键列上创建适当的索引是非常必要的。但是过多冗余的索引反而会影响插入/更新时的性能,所以需要权衡利弊后做出决策。另外要记得及时重建失效索引以及删除不再使用的旧索引。

实施缓存机制

通过引入缓存层可以有效减轻数据库的压力,尤其是在面对高并发请求的情况下。阿里云提供了Redis作为分布式键值存储解决方案,可用于临时保存频繁访问但不易变动的数据副本。当客户端发起查询时优先从缓存中获取内容,只有当命中失败时才会转而向源数据库请求最新数据。

监控与调优

最后但同样重要的一点是要持续关注数据库运行状态并进行针对性的优化工作。借助阿里云提供的监控工具如ARMS(Application Real-Time Monitoring Service),我们可以实时跟踪各项性能指标的变化趋势,发现潜在瓶颈所在。基于这些分析结果采取相应措施,例如调整参数设置、重构应用程序逻辑等,从而进一步提升整体性能水平。

通过对阿里云主机上的数据库进行全面而细致地优化处理,不仅能够显著加快查询响应时间,还能提高整个系统的稳定性和可靠性。希望上述建议能为企业用户带来有价值的参考,助力其实现更高效的数据管理与运营。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/167455.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 2025年1月23日 上午1:13
下一篇 2025年1月23日 上午1:13

相关推荐

  • 使用云虚拟主机时,怎样保证外网数据传输的安全性?

    随着互联网技术的快速发展,越来越多的企业和组织选择使用云虚拟主机来部署应用程序和服务。在享受云计算带来的便利的如何确保外网数据传输的安全性成为了关键问题。本文将探讨几种有效的措施,帮助用户在使用云虚拟主机时保护数据传输的安全。 一、加密通信 为了防止敏感信息在网络中被窃取或篡改,必须采用加密协议对传输的数据进行加密处理。常见的加密方式包括SSL/TLS(安全…

    2025年1月22日
    300
  • 如何在云主机Linux上安装和配置LAMP栈?

    LAMP(Linux、Apache、MySQL 和 PHP)是一种流行的开源 Web 开发平台,通常用于托管动态网站和应用程序。本文将详细介绍如何在云主机的 Linux 系统上安装和配置 LAMP 栈。 准备工作 在开始安装之前,请确保您的云主机已经运行了最新的 Linux 发行版,并且您具有 root 或 sudo 权限。如果您使用的是 Ubuntu 或 …

    2025年1月23日
    400
  • 在ASP.NET云主机上如何实现自动备份和恢复功能?

    随着互联网技术的发展,越来越多的企业和个人开始选择将应用程序部署到云端。ASP.NET是一种流行的Web开发框架,常用于构建高效、可扩展的Web应用程序。确保数据的安全性和可用性是每个开发者必须考虑的问题之一。在ASP.NET云主机上实现自动备份和恢复功能显得尤为重要。 一、了解需求 我们需要明确自动备份和恢复的具体需求。对于大多数网站来说,主要包括以下几个…

    2025年1月22日
    500
  • 云主机流量费用是如何计算的?怎样避免超支?

    云主机流量费用的计算基于用户在一定周期内使用的网络带宽,通常以GB为单位。不同的服务商可能会有不同的计费方式,但大多数情况下,都是按照流入和流出的数据量分别进行收费。一些服务商会提供一定的免费额度,超出部分则按阶梯定价。例如,某服务商提供的5GB月度免费流量套餐,如果当月使用了8GB,则需要支付额外3GB的费用。 如何避免超支 为了避免超支,可以采取以下措施…

    2025年1月20日
    600
  • 云主机与独立服务器的数据备份策略有何不同?

    如今,企业或个人在选择服务器时通常会在云主机和独立服务器之间做出抉择。这两种服务器类型不仅在性能、成本和灵活性上存在差异,其数据备份策略也有所不同。 一、云主机的数据备份策略 1. 自动化程度高 云主机提供商会为用户定期自动备份数据,无需用户过多干预。大多数情况下,用户可以自行设置备份的频率、时间以及存储位置等参数。而且,由于云主机是基于云计算技术构建的,因…

    2025年1月20日
    500

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部